Innovative Environmental Technologies Project Supported under the TÜBİTAK ARDEB 1001 Program
A research project led by Prof. Dr. Mehmet Çakmakcı from the Department of Environmental Engineering, Faculty of Civil Engineering, has been awarded funding under the TÜBİTAK ARDEB 1001 Scientific and Technological Research Projects Support Program.
